Have you spent your whole life chasing the love and approval of a father who was never truly there for you?Growing up with a narcissistic father leaves invisible scars, ones that shape your self-worth, your relationships, and even how you see yourself as a woman. If you’ve ever felt unworthy, silenced, or trapped in the shadow of a toxic parent, this book was written for you.In Adult Daughters of Narcissistic Fathers, you’ll finally find words for the pain you’ve carried for years. It speaks to the unique trauma of a father-daughter relationship marked by narcissistic abuse. Unlike other books that only touch on toxic parents in general, this guide speaks directly to women like you who endured the deep wound of being unseen, criticized, or controlled by the very man who was supposed to protect and love you.Inside, you will discover:The patterns of narcissistic fathers and emotionally unavailable fathers, and how they shape daughters differently than sonsHow the “father wound” impacts your confidence, self-worth, and ability to trustWhy you may be drawn to unhealthy relationships, and how to finally break the cyclePractical strategies for healing from narcissistic abuse and reclaiming your voiceTools to set healthy boundaries, release shame, and build the life you deserveThis book is more than insight. It offers a path to freedom. Through compassionate guidance, real stories, and evidence-based recovery practices, you’ll learn that you are not broken, you are not alone, and it is never too late to heal.If you are ready to stop reliving your father’s shadow and begin living as your authentic self, this book will help you reclaim your power, heal your father wound, and step into a future defined by strength rather than trauma.
